Meet the team:
The IT Core Services team is a global organization responsible for delivering and evolving Dexcom’s Microsoft 365 and digital workplace ecosystem, including collaboration, messaging, identity, automation, and emerging AI capabilities. The team enables secure, scalable, and cost‑effective use of M365 and AI technologies across the enterprise, with a strong focus on security, governance, standardization, and operational excellence.
Dexcom is seeking a Senior Business Systems Analyst with experience across the Microsoft 365 (M365) ecosystem and related enterprise platforms. This role focuses on analyzing business needs, documenting and communicating requirements, and enabling scalable, secure, and cost‑effective solutions across M365 technologies, including the Power Platform and emerging AI capabilities. The ideal candidate brings strong analytical skills, a creator mindset, and the ability to translate complex business processes into clear documentation, visuals, and functional specifications that guide system configuration and delivery.
Where you come in:
- Analyze complex business problems and identify opportunities to improve processes through Microsoft 365, automation, and AI‑enabled solutions.
- Elicit, analyze, and document business, functional, and non‑functional requirements; translate them into clear system specifications, user stories, and solution artifacts.
- Document current‑state and future‑state business processes, including process flows, swim lanes, gaps, risks, and improvement opportunities.
- Partner with platform and technical teams to design, enable, and configure solutions across the Microsoft 365 ecosystem, including Power Platform, Copilot and Copilot Studio, and other M365 services, in alignment with security and governance standards.
- Support AI‑enabled initiatives, including Copilot extensibility and Azure AI services, by documenting use cases, requirements, controls, risks, and expected outcomes.
- Plan and support unit, integration, and user acceptance testing to ensure solutions meet defined requirements. Produce and maintain high‑quality documentation, including requirements documents, process maps, solution visuals, and user guidance.
- Communicate effectively with technical and non‑technical stakeholders, clearly explaining business needs, system behavior, risks, and dependencies.
- Use Jira and Confluence to manage requirements, backlogs, documentation, and delivery artifacts across Agile, Waterfall, or hybrid delivery models.
- Own the end‑to‑end Business Analysis methodology and templates; provide guidance and mentorship to junior Business Analysts.
- Act as a single point of contact for subject matter experts, representing business processes and requirements to delivery teams.
- Support enterprise initiatives such as Identity Governance and Administration (IGA), including requirements discovery, process documentation, and solution evaluation.
- Lead or coordinate small to medium initiatives or workstreams as needed; monitor and report status, risks, and issues to Project or Program Managers.
- Perform additional duties as assigned in support of IT Core Services objectives.
What makes you successful:
- Proven 8+ years' experience as a Business Analyst or Business Systems Analyst supporting enterprise systems.
- 3-5 years' experience working within the Microsoft 365 environment, with exposure to Power Platform, Copilot, and AI‑enabled solutions from a requirements or enablement perspective.
- Strong skills in business analysis, process modeling, and functional documentation.
- Demonstrated ability to create clear, well‑structured written and visual artifacts to support stakeholder alignment and decision‑making.
- Excellent communication, collaboration, and stakeholder management skills.
- Experience using Jira and Confluence for requirements tracking, sprint support, and documentation.
- Ability to work independently while managing multiple initiatives
